I have a laptop and a new desktop build. when I installed win 7 premium 64 upgrade they started rebooting. Long story short, the problem was Zone Alarm, I uninstalled it and haven't had one reboot since. Hope this helps a lot of you with reboots. It took me long enough to find it. Thanks
